cuốn sách gpt4 ai đã làm

Đối tượng std :: vector có chứa đối tượng boost :: tùy chọn có thể di chuyển được không? Tăng cường di chuyển :: tùy chọn?

In lại Tác giả: Vũ trụ không gian Thời gian cập nhật: 2023-11-04 15:22:52 26 4
mua khóa gpt4 Nike

std::vector> foo;
// điền foo.

Vì vectơ tiêu chuẩn mới có thể di chuyển được, nhưng rất tiếc là họ chưa làm cho các tùy chọn có thể di chuyển được :(

  1. Có kế hoạch nào để làm cho nó có thể tháo rời tùy ý không?

  2. Vectơ trên vẫn có thể di chuyển hiệu quả như các vectơ khác chứ?

câu trả lời hay nhất

Bất kể loại lưu trữ nào,std::vector Các thành phần đều có thể tháo rời. Thao tác di chuyển chỉ yêu cầu một con trỏ trong vectơ tới bộ đệm bên trong移动sang một vectơ khác. Loại đối tượng được lưu trữ trong bộ đệm này không quan trọng vì chúng vẫn giữ nguyên vị trí.

Giới thiệu về c++ - Các đối tượng std::vector có chứa các đối tượng boost::Optional có thể di chuyển được không? Tăng cường di chuyển :: tùy chọn? , chúng tôi đã tìm thấy một câu hỏi tương tự trên Stack Overflow: https://stackoverflow.com/questions/14986461/

26 4 0
không gian vũ trụ
Hồ sơ

Tôi là một lập trình viên xuất sắc, rất giỏi!

Nhận phiếu giảm giá taxi Didi miễn phí
Phiếu giảm giá taxi Didi
Chứng chỉ ICP Bắc Kinh số 000000
Hợp tác quảng cáo: 1813099741@qq.com 6ren.com
Xem sitemap của VNExpress